GloriousBender • 3 yr. ago WebFeb 20, 2024 · In the left navigation of the Microsoft Teams admin center, select Analytics & reports > Usage reports. On the View reports tab, under Report, select Teams live event usage. Under Date range, select a predefined range or set a custom range. You can set a range to show data up to a year, six months before and after the current date. WebTo manage the reports, click Calendar , select the live event, and go to the Event resources section. To download a recording or report, click Download next to the item. To delete all the listed items, click Delete all . Note: If you delete something by mistake, you have up to seven days to restore it. Click Refresh to see the latest reports ... how many ounces are 20 grams
